Boil or steam half of the broccoli until it's slightly tender. Cook the other half a bit longer. Once the second half is well-cooked, blend it in a blender with 4 tablespoons of cottage cheese, 2 tablespoon of water, and adjust the salt. The consistency should be creamy.
In a baking dish or ramekin, place a layer of the cottage cheese cream. Add, in a single layer, your slightly tender broccoli on top.
Cover the broccoli with the creamy mixture. Sprinkle Parmesan or Mozzarela on the top.
Preheat the oven to 200 degrees Celsius (392 degrees Fahrenheit). Bake the gratin until it turns golden brown.
